vig i've been to some other capping message boards and already there are morons with no proven track record (pay and free cappers) who claim they've made a killing in BaseBall and that they're going to do it again this year. My fear that it's only going to be a matter of time until we see it on here within the next few days with the usual morons who post crap on here every day ..........why should i care you ask? Because I've noticed they're a lot of new guys on here who weren't here last Baseball season who are going to get sucked in by some of these idiots who claimed to make hundreds of thousands of dollars last season which is obviously not true (you'll find out that 95% of all posters here lie about their record and winnings). The best way to try to make money off these statfox message boards is not to following anyone elses picks blindly, but rather exchange, share and read information and then make your own judgement. If you agree with them, great if you don't then that might even be better. We've already seen a lot of crap on here the last few months and i'm afraid we might see even more come summer time.
